HMC674LC3C/HMC674LP3E
Data Sheet
Rev. K | Page 6 of 14
ABSOLUTE MAXIMUM RATINGS
Table 7.
Parameter
Rating
Supply Voltage
Input (VCCI to GND)
−0.5 V to +4 V
Output (VCCO to GND)
−0.5 V to +4 V
Positive Differential (VCCI to VCCO)
−0.5 V to +3.3 V
VEE Supply to GND
−3.3 V to +0.5 V
Input Voltage
−2 V to +2 V
Differential
−2 V to +2 V
Latch Enable (LE/LE)
−0.5 V to VCCI + 0.5 V
Applied Voltage (HYS)
VEE to GND
Current
Maximum Input
±20 mA
Output
40 mA
Continuous Power Dissipation (PDISS), TA = 85°C
Derate 43.5 mW/°C Above 85°C
(HMC674LP3E)
1.74 W
Derate 20.4 mW/°C Above 85°C
(HMC674LC3C)
0.816 W
Junction Temperature
125°C
Maximum Peak Reflow Temperature1
MSL1 and MSL3
260°C
Thermal Resistance (θJC)
HMC674LP3E
23°C/W
HMC674LC3C
49°C/W
Storage Temperature Range
−65°C to +150°C
Operating Temperature Range
−40°C to +85°C
ESD Sensitivity, Human Body Model (HBM)
Class 1A

Stresses at or above those listed under Absolute Maximum
Ratings may cause permanent damage to the product. This is a
stress rating only; functional operation of the product at these
or any other conditions above those indicated in the operational
section of this specification is not implied. Operation beyond
the maximum operating conditions for extended periods may
affect product reliability.
